General liability business insurance protects businesses from claims of bodily injury, property damage, and personal injury.
-
Bodily Injury Coverage: Covers medical expenses and legal fees if someone is injured on your business premises or due to your operations.
-
Property Damage Coverage: Protects against claims for damage to someone else's property caused by your business activities.
-
Personal Injury Coverage: Covers claims related to defamation, slander, or invasion of privacy.
-
Legal Defense Costs: Provides coverage for legal fees incurred in defending against covered claims, even if the claims are unfounded.​
